Open position

Backend Developer

We are looking for a Backend Developer to design and build scalable services that power the Documind platform.

Istanbul (Hybrid) Full-time Engineering

About the company

  • With our Documind platform, we transform document-heavy operations and help enterprises gain true document intelligence.
  • Powered by Vision Language Models (VLM) and Large Language Models (LLM), Documind automatically extracts accurate data from documents, reducing error rates and increasing productivity.
  • Documind can turn information from both text and image-based documents into structured data within minutes, helping our customers automate repetitive document workflows.

Responsibilities

  • Design, develop, and maintain scalable backend services and APIs using Python (preferably FastAPI).
  • Work on data models and database schemas, ensuring performance and reliability.
  • Integrate LLM and deep learning based services into existing systems.
  • Write tests and participate in code reviews to keep code quality high.
  • Contribute to deployment and operations using Docker and modern DevOps tooling.
  • Collaborate closely with product and frontend teams to ship new features end-to-end.

Requirements

  • Strong experience with Python and modern web frameworks (preferably FastAPI, Django, or Flask).
  • Proven track record designing and building RESTful APIs.
  • Experience with relational databases (e.g. PostgreSQL) and optionally NoSQL data stores.
  • Familiarity with containerization using Docker.
  • A collaborative mindset, strong problem-solving skills, and eagerness to learn new technologies.
  • Ability to read and understand technical documentation in English.

Nice to have

  • Hands-on experience with AI / LLM-related projects.
  • Experience working on high-throughput, large-scale backend systems.
  • Experience with at least one major cloud provider (AWS, GCP, Azure).
  • Practical experience in software or cloud architecture design.